Don't waste your money!
Fit faucet fine - problem was, it restricted the flow so much that we developed pinhole leaks in the arm of the faucet. Now we will have to 1) buy a new stainless steel faucet to replace the one we had which was only a few years old (Cost $289) 2) Have the plumber come out and install it (Cost Approx $125) And to top it all - if someone accidentally turned the faucet on all the way the Brita filter FLEW off the end of the faucet like a projectile! So, it's now in the trash along with our 3 year old Delta Faucet. Didn't save us anything - but it sure COST us a lot! Don't waste your money on this piece of garbage!
